Mental strength and self-awareness in stable bipolar disorder patients

Updated

Abstract

In a study of 142 patients with bipolar disorder, total insight scores were negatively correlated with perception of the future.

  • Family cohesion was significantly associated with insight related to relabeling psychotic experiences and attention impulsivity.
  • No significant relationship was found between total insight and total resilience scores.
  • Resilience scores were negatively correlated with the number of depressive episodes and past suicide attempts.
  • Aggression, impulsivity, and temperament scores significantly predicted resilience in patients.
